Why Live in Kapalua
Kapalua, a neighborhood in Lahaina, is nestled against expansive nature preserves and bordered by white sand beaches, offering a blend of natural beauty and luxurious living. The area is known for its world-class golf courses, including the Plantation Course, which hosts the PGA Sentry Tournament of Champions, and the Bay Course, famous for its ocean-overlooking 17th hole. Residents enjoy prestigious oceanfront and oceanview condominiums in the Ironwoods community, single-family mansions near the Kapalua Plantation Golf Course, and townhouses at Napili Gardens. The neighborhood's unique weather pattern features gentle winds and occasional sprinkles, leading to beautiful afternoons. Kapalua Bay Beach and D. T. Fleming Beach Park are popular spots for snorkeling and surfing, with lifeguards, playgrounds, and picnic areas enhancing the beach experience. The striking Dragon’s Teeth and Kapalua Labyrinth offer stunning natural attractions formed by ancient volcanic activity. Dining options include Merriman’s Kapalua for farm-to-table cuisine and Sansei Seafood Restaurant for creative sushi and karaoke. Local shopping is convenient with K’alale Fruit Shack, Napali Market, and the Napili Farmers Market nearby. Public transportation is accessible via the Maui Bus, connecting residents to the broader Lahaina area.
